Regarding the logistics of medical pharmaceuticals.

A detailed explanation of the types and distribution channels of medical pharmaceuticals on the blog!

I believe there are few people who have never used prescription medications before. Since pharmaceuticals often have a direct impact on the human body, high-quality handling and services that meet the temperature, vibration, and light protection standards set by pharmaceutical manufacturers for each drug are required during distribution and logistics. To satisfy these requirements, it seems necessary to operate in accordance with the "Good Distribution Practice (GDP) Guidelines for Pharmaceuticals" issued by the Ministry of Health, Labour and Welfare. While the GDP in our country does not have legal binding power, it can be said that handling in accordance with GDP is extremely important to ensure safety and security. *For more details about the blog, please refer to the related links. Necessary considerations for the appointment of a CLO

A blog explaining the necessary measures for shippers to function effectively with CLO!

Finally, the regulations on overtime work in the logistics industry have begun, and the shipping companies, logistics providers, and receiving companies will collaborate to further improve the appropriateness of logistics and enhance productivity. The "Guidelines for Initiatives by Shippers and Logistics Providers for the Appropriateness of Logistics and Productivity Improvement," issued by the Ministry of Economy, Trade and Industry, the Ministry of Agriculture, Forestry and Fisheries, and the Ministry of Land, Infrastructure, Transport and Tourism in June 2023, particularly require shippers to appoint a person (such as an executive) to oversee and manage logistics operations comprehensively within their organization to implement initiatives for the appropriateness of logistics and productivity improvement. In this article, I would like to clarify the role of the Chief Logistics Officer (CLO) and outline the necessary responses for shippers to ensure the CLO functions effectively. *For more details, please refer to the related links. Series NX Research Institute President Speaks: Part 5 - Impact on Logistics and Work Styles in Japan and Europe

Changes in economic activities due to the deepening of EU principles. An explanation of the impact of the introduction of the euro on logistics, among other things.

The movement of people, goods, capital, and services becoming free within the EU has had a significant impact on the logistics industry. Particularly with the introduction of the euro, it has become possible to set optimal locations considering lead times and delivery costs. Major logistics companies in Europe had previously positioned their own distribution centers in optimal locations in each country, but after the introduction of the euro, they began treating multiple countries as a single market. To adopt a flexible system that meets customer demands, they started selling their own distribution center facilities to logistics real estate operators, often real estate companies within their own group, and then re-leasing them under the same conditions as the customer contracts. As a result, when customers requested the relocation of distribution hubs, they were able to respond relatively easily by moving to another location. *For more details, you can view the related links.
